+Sat Apr  9 15:32:00 UTC 2016 - [email protected]
+
+- update to version 3.8.0
+  * Enhancements
+    - Add proper file extension filters to all file dialogs - 6b8f57d (thanks 
to @MKleusberg)
+    - Improved error handling, e.g. more error messages with more detailed 
error descriptions - #362, #363, 1696ad1 (thanks to @schdub and @MKleusberg)
+    - Allow changing table columns even when there is a foreign key constraint 
on the table - #362 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- When holding Ctrl and Shift while clicking on a cell with a foreign key 
set, the browser now jumps to the referenced record - #192 (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Add option for disabling the SQL error indicators in the Execute SQL 
area - #302 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add an option for setting the colours of fields with regular and binary 
data - #377 (thanks to @schdub)
+    - Use the name of the imported file as default suggestion for a table name 
during CSV import - #376 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Save filter values, sort order and column widths for all tables when 
switching the current table or tab; also save the settings in the project file 
- 748f06d (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Show a small clear button inside each filter box - 944e22a (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Add basic support for different 'display formats', i.e. a conversion of 
the contents of a column into a different format for display purposes (e.g. 
converting a Unix epoch into an actual date) - 7c1d237, 22e858d (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Remove deleted files from list of recently opened files - #379 (thanks 
to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add a new option for horizontal tiling of the code and result view in 
the Execute SQL area - #380 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Move execution time of the SQL statement to the top of the result view 
in the Execute SQL area - #381 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add 'x rows affected' information to the result view of the Execute SQL 
area - 82292c2 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add built-in UTF16 and UTF16CI collation - #391 (thanks to 
@sebastian-philipp)
+    - Add Ctrl+R shortcut (besides F5) for the refresh table button - #388 
(th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add option for setting the font and font size of the text in the table 
browser view - #383 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Support opening of read only database files - #402 (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Add option for showing the rowid column in the data browser view - #408 
(th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add option for showing the text in the data browser view using a 
different encoding - #414 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add option for setting an escape character for the filters in the data 
browser - #421 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add a small delay before applying a new filter value instead of 
performing an instantaneous search to improve performance on large tables - 
#415 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Automatically add '%...%' wildcards to a filter query - #415 (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Add Delete and Alt+Delete keyboard shortcuts for setting the current 
cell to empty string or NULL in the data browser view - #443 (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Add new option for moving the Edit cell data dialog into a dock which is 
locked to the main window and stays opened - #416, #440, #441 (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Allow drag-&-dropping text and files on a cell in the data browser - 
#441 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Add keyboard shortcuts for recently opened files - #432 (thanks to 
@MKleusberg)
+    - Add new option for setting a SQL script which gets executed whenever any 
database file is opened - #451 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Allow pasting data (e.g. from a spreadsheet) directly into the data 
browser view - #453 (thanks to @MilosSubotic)
+  * Bug fixes
+    - Fix missing SQL log when query contains a line break, also trim the log 
- #337, #356 (thanks to @schdub and @MKleusberg)
+    - Also set foreign key settings when creating a new database instead of 
just setting them when opening a file - 212116a (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Fix drawing of Unicode characters in the SQL editor where the font 
settings wouldn't apply as they should have - #365 (thanks to @SevenLines)
+Allow values greater than 10000 in the user_version pragma of a database - 
#366 (thanks to @schdub)
+    - Fix adding new a record into a table where all fields are set to a 
default value - #369 (thanks to @schdub)
+    - Fix resizing of the code and result view in the Execute SQL area - 
6806a9b (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Fix error message when changing table - #390 (thanks to @MKleusberg and 
@GeorgijK)
+    - Fix parsing of double backticks and double quotes used to escape a 
single one in create table statements - 160bc87, dce47b3 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Fix handling of tables when their name contains a backtick - #387 
(th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Try to set a better window position when opening the Edit cell data 
dialog - #342, #394 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Fix possible infinite loop in the Edit cell data dialog - #444 (thanks 
to @manisandro)
+    - Fix bug when pressing the cancel button in the dialog you see when 
you're closing a database with unsaved changes - #432 (thanks to @MKleusberg)
+    - Don't allow conflicting field names in the Edit Table dialog - #460 
(thanks to @MKleusberg)
+  * Translations
+    - Add translation into Traditional Chinese - #425 (thanks to 
@PeterDaveHello)
